How much do amazon data entry j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for amazon data entry in Boston, MA is $21.16,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.74 and $23.75 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Amazon data entry?

An Amazon Data Entry job involves inputting, updating, and managing data related to product listings, inventory, orders, and customer details. Responsibilities may include entering product descriptions, prices, and SKUs into Amazon’s database or third-party tools. Accuracy and attention to detail are essential to ensure correct product information and smooth operations. This role may be performed remotely or in an office, depending on the employer.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an Amazon data entry?

As an Amazon Data Entry specialist, your day typically involves inputting, verifying, and updating extensive product or order information into Amazon’s database systems. You may also assist in identifying and correcting data discrepancies, preparing reports, and collaborating with other departments such as inventory, customer service, or fulfillment teams. Attention to detail is essential, as much of the work requires precise entry of large volumes of data to support accurate listings and timely order processing. This role offers valuable exposure to e-commerce operations and can provide a stepping-stone to positions in data analysis, logistics, or operations within the company.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Amazon data entry position?

To excel as an Amazon Data Entry specialist, you should possess strong attention to detail, fast and accurate typing skills, and a basic understanding of data management,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with databases, Excel, and Amazon-specific inventory or order management systems is typically required. Effective time management, reliability, and the ability to collaborate within a team are valuable soft skills for this role. These competencies are crucial to maintain data integrity, meet tight deadlines, and ensure smooth online operations for Amazon's vast marketplace.

Amazon.com, Inc., commonly known as Amazon, is an American multinational technology company. It was foun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994 and initially started as an online marketplace for books. Since then, Amazon has expanded its operations and become one of the largest e-commerce companies in the world. Amazon's primary business is its online retail platform, where customers can purchase a vast array of products, including electronics, clothing, books, home goods, and much more. The company offers a convenient and user-friendly shopping experience, with features such as fast shipping, customer reviews, and personalized recommendations. In addition to its e-commerce platform, Amazon has diversified its business into various other areas. One of its notable ventures is Amazon Web Services (AWS), a comprehensive cloud computing platform that provides services such as storage, compute power, and database management to individuals and businesses. AWS has become a leader in the cloud computing industry, powering many websites and applications worldwide. Amazon has also developed its own consumer electronics, including the popular Amazon Kindle e-reader, Fire tablets, Fire TV streaming devices, and the Alexa-powered Echo smart speakers. The Alexa voice assistant, integrated into these devices, allows users to interact with their devices using voice commands, perform tasks, and access information. Furthermore, Amazon has expanded into media and entertainment. It operates Prime Video, a streaming service that offers a wide range of movies, TV shows, and original content. Amazon Music provides a platform for streaming and purchasing digital music, while Audible offers audiobooks and other audio content. The company's commitment to customer satisfaction and convenience is demonstrated by its membership program, Amazon Prime. Prime members receive various benefits, including free two-day shipping, access to streaming services, exclusive deals, and more.
